The Incentive Travel Market was valued at USD 53.56 Billion in 2024, and is expected to reach USD 61.23 Billion by 2030, rising at a CAGR of 5.23%. Market growth is fueled by evolving corporate strategies focused on employee engagement, motivation, and retention. Incentive travel is increasingly favored over traditional rewards, offering personalized and experiential value that resonates with modern workforce expectations. Businesses are using travel-based incentives to enhance team dynamics, recognize top performance, and align employees with corporate culture. Technological advancements in booking systems have streamlined program management, while globalization and a dispersed workforce have further encouraged the adoption of travel rewards. The rising demand for tailored, immersive experiences and the integration of such programs into broader organizational recognition strategies continue to drive expansion in the global incentive travel market.

Key Market Drivers

Rising Corporate Sector

The expanding corporate sector is playing a pivotal role in propelling the global incentive travel market. As businesses grow and compete for top-tier talent, there is an increasing focus on engagement and employee satisfaction. According to recent data, the global number of businesses rose by approximately 3.3% in 2023, following a 4.2% increase in 2022. Companies are turning to incentive travel programs as effective tools to reward top performers, cultivate team cohesion, and reinforce organizational values.

These programs deliver unique and memorable travel experiences that go beyond conventional rewards. With the rise of multinational operations and remote teams, such initiatives also serve as essential opportunities for face-to-face collaboration and cultural alignment. The popularity of "bleisure" travel, which blends business and leisure, adds further appeal by enhancing work-life balance. Innovations in travel logistics and planning platforms are making it easier for companies to offer personalized, meaningful, and impactful incentive trips - fueling sustained growth in the sector.

Key Market Challenges

Rising Travel Cost

Increasing travel expenses pose a significant hurdle for the global incentive travel market. Escalating costs related to airfare, accommodations, and transportation make it challenging for companies to offer comprehensive travel rewards while maintaining budgetary balance. Influencing factors include inflation, fluctuating fuel prices, and heightened demand for premium services.

As a result, many businesses are reevaluating their incentive travel offerings, potentially opting for shorter trips, more budget-friendly destinations, or even virtual alternatives. The challenge lies in providing impactful travel experiences that align with cost constraints. Organizations must strike a balance between delivering high-value incentives and managing expenditures. To address this issue, companies and travel providers are working together to optimize logistics, negotiate competitive pricing, and design creative yet cost-effective programs that maintain the motivational power of incentive travel.

Key Market Trends

Integration of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R)

The incorporation of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) into incentive travel programs is becoming a prominent trend in the global market. Businesses are increasingly embedding CSR components - such as sustainability initiatives, environmental conservation, and community service - into travel rewards to foster a deeper sense of purpose. This evolution is in response to rising expectations from employees, especially younger generations, who prioritize ethical and socially responsible practices.

By including volunteer work, eco-conscious activities, or support for local communities within travel experiences, companies not only enrich participant engagement but also enhance their brand image as values-driven organizations. CSR-integrated incentive travel offers a meaningful blend of leisure and impact, helping employees feel more connected to the company’s mission while contributing to broader social and environmental goals. This trend reflects a shift toward more holistic and purpose-led employee rewards.
